In 1749 Brisson was engaged by Réaumur to care for his collection of natural history and to help him in his observations and experiments, thus putting him in the line of fire of the great rivalry between Réaumur and Buffon. Buffon in his Histoire Naturelle had attempted a general description of the animal world and Réaumur desired to undertake a similar enterprise in which Brisson was to play the principal role. In 1756 Brisson published the present work in which he announced the project and dealt with the study of the first two classes - quadrupeds and cetaceans. But in 1757 upon Réaumur's death he had to give up the care of the collection which was transferred to the Cabinet du Roi under the supervision of Buffon, and to which he was denied access.
